Can an American become a German police officer?

Many states of Germany hace changed their apployment policy. A few years ago you had to be a German citizen to become a police officer. Now it is possible to become a police officer without being a German citizen in some States (like Hamburg).

When did Hitler become a German citizen?

Adolf Hitler became a German citizen in 1932 until he died in 1945.
